About Jatipur Village

Jatipur is a large village in Samalkha tehsil, in the district of Panipat, Haryana.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 4,198, made up of 2,490 males and 1,708 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 686 females per 1000 males. The village covers 555 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 132101,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.

Getting to Jatipur

The census records public bus service for Jatipur as Available within village. Private bus service is recorded as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
